This is made up of 4 weeks’ paid annual leave and 1.6 weeks’ paid public holiday … Web10 aug. 2009 · In the UK, the statutory minimum holiday entitlement for full-time workers rose in April 2009 to 5.6 weeks, or 28 days. The entitlement is to paid time off. For most workers, payment is at the normal rate of salary. Where variable hours or rates of pay apply, payment is based broadly on the average rate of pay during the previous 12-week period.
